Yes, you can change touch sensitivity on most devices. Go to Settings > Accessibility > Touch Sensitivity on your smartphone or tablet. Adjust the sensitivity to make your screen more or less responsive based on your needs.

  1. What is touch sensitivity? Touch sensitivity refers to how responsive your device's screen is to touch inputs, which you can adjust for comfort.
  2. Can touch sensitivity be adjusted on all devices? Most modern smartphones and tablets allow users to change touch sensitivity within their accessibility settings.
  3. Why would I want to change my device's touch sensitivity? Adjusting touch sensitivity can enhance usability for those with specific accessibility needs or preferences for more or less responsiveness.
  4. Where can I find touch sensitivity settings? Touch sensitivity settings are typically located under Settings > Accessibility on your device.
